  • QuestionIs there a locatin GPS system if I loose the drone?

    Asked by 4st.

    • Answer The drone does have a gps system. You also have a flight record that you can trace to the drone. Ensure you have sufficient satellites before you launch. At time the M3 has a latency in acquiring satellites, you can launch with about 8 and hover about 3 feet to reach 11 where you are safe to go. If you go up with less than 5, you can have a fly away. Also learn how to emergency stop your motors and how to not panic when you think it is not responding to your commands. When your homepoint is locked, the drone will return to launch site if connection is lost.

  • QuestionIs this drone geofenced?

    Asked by Raymond.

    • Answer Dear customer, Thanks for your inquiry. DJI's Geospatial Environment Online (GEO) is a best-in-class geospatial information system providing DJI users with up-to-date guidance on areas where flight may be limited due to safety concerns or regulations. It combines the latest airspace information, a warning and flight-restriction system, a self-authorizing unlocking mechanism for specific locations, and a minimally-invasive accountability system for those decisions. This system is often referred to as “geofencing” and replaces DJI’s first-generation No Fly Zone system implemented in 2013.
